Job Description
Our Site Manager is looking for an experienced and dedicated Class 1 Driver to support the continued growth of their Depot.
You will be responsible for:
- Making bulk collections and deliveriesfrom our nationwide network of depots and some of our biggest customers.
- Working to time critical deadlines and set collection times
- Ensuring we provide a service to customers\’ that is second to none
- Keeping & maintaining regular records & journey details
- Assist in loading or unloading
You\’ll also need a flexible outlook, a friendly personality and smart appearance and the desire to deliver world class customer service. In return we can offer you (alongside some fantastic company benefits)
- Company uniform
- Fully funded CPC renewal
- Flexible overtime
- Modern and well maintained fleet
Qualifications
1 year LGV C+E experience is required.
YouMUST also have:
- A valid UK Driving Licence with CE entitlement
- A valid UK CPC Card
- A valid UK Digital Tachograph Card

How to prepare for a job interview at DPD UK
✨Know Your Route
Familiarise yourself with the local area and key routes you might be taking. Being able to discuss your knowledge of the roads and any potential challenges shows that you're prepared and proactive.
✨Highlight Customer Service Skills
As a Class 1 Driver, you'll be representing the company daily. Be ready to share examples of how you've provided excellent customer service in previous roles, as this is crucial for DPD's reputation.
✨Demonstrate Safety Awareness
Safety is paramount in driving jobs. Be prepared to discuss your understanding of safety regulations, vehicle maintenance, and how you ensure safe driving practices during your journeys.
✨Show Flexibility and Team Spirit
DPD values a flexible outlook and teamwork. Share experiences where you've adapted to changing circumstances or worked collaboratively with others to achieve a common goal.
